A frustrated cyclist’s tools fit the firearms market.
During Range Day at SHOT Show 2016, Guns&Tactics found a booth tucked away in the back. There, we found a tool that has a place in everyone’s toolbox. The Fix It Sticks is a compact set of tools containing several screwdriver heads, torx heads, and hex heads, plus something special: miniature torque limiters. The limiter prevents over-torquing of small screws and nuts. Like scope mounts.


Fix It Sticks were the brainchild of Brian Davis, an avid cyclist who became frustrated with the common multi-tools he carried in his pocket.
After experimenting with numerous tools, he found they all had the same problems — compact tools gave you no leverage, and tools that gave you leverage were not compact enough. He figured there had to be a better way.
Numerous sketches, prototypes, and manufactured parts later — the Fix It Stick was born!
